The effects of fluid restriction on hydration status and subjective feelings in man

1 min read /
Nutrition Health & Wellness

Prof. Shirreffs and colleagues describe in her paper how dehydration induced by fluid restriction seems to increase feelings of thirst, headaches and tiredness and how it reduces the feelings of alertness and concentration.
